Geothermal Energy Taufkirchen – In Operation
The geothermal power plant in Taufkirchen near Munich is a pioneer in renewable energy for the Bavarian region. Since its commissioning, it has been delivering environmentally friendly district heating to households and businesses in the area. By harnessing deep thermal water layers, the plant generates base-load capable energy entirely independent of weather conditions and fossil fuels.
With its continuous supply of low-carbon energy, Taufkirchen makes an active contribution to the energy transition – sustainable, efficient, and future-oriented.
Geothermal Energy Palling
Geoprime is developing a geothermal heating plant in Palling, Upper Bavaria.
The plant will supply the municipality of Palling with thermal energy and feed additional geothermal heat into the planned interregional heating network.
To ensure a reliable and base-load capable energy supply, up to three production wells and three reinjection wells are planned. These wells will reach depths of 4,700 to 5,200 meters, targeting deep thermal water reservoirs in the Upper Jurassic carbonate formations with temperatures around 122 °C and flow rates exceeding 150 liters per second per well.
Preparations for the drilling site are scheduled to begin in the second half of 2025. The heating plant is expected to go into operation by the end of 2027. From then on, Palling and surrounding communities will be supplied with geothermal heat.
